The contract requires the manufacture and delivery of 60 military medical utility pouches in Universal Camouflage Pattern, adhering strictly to federal and military standards for labeling, packaging, and hazardous materials handling. These pouches are intended for use by military medical units and must meet all technical and quality specifications mandated by the Department of Defense to ensure operational readiness and safety in field conditions. The work must be completed and delivered by the specified deadline to support urgent logistical needs. The solicitation is classified as a subcontract under NAICS code 339920, managed by C AND T SUPPLY CHAIN on behalf of the Department of Defense. Proposals must be submitted by August 10, 2026, with the place of performance designated as JBSA Fort Sam Houston, Texas, where the pouches will be received and distributed. The contract posting date is July 30, 2026, indicating a short turnaround for interested vendors to prepare and submit compliant bids. All parties must ensure full compliance with federal regulations governing defense supply chain activities, particularly concerning packaging protocols and hazardous material handling procedures.
